    On a side note:
    As for making NS plushys Kain-TSA and me investigated this, b/c we were thinking of getting into contact with the NS dev team to have stuffed onos and gorgies made. And we would run the distribution for them

    We did some independant research before hand and we came up with this.

    After getting permission from owners of of the rights to the gorge, onos etc, getting artwork comissioned to a good plush toy maker, having a prototype shipped back to us and having it agreed upon, then having it contracted to be mass produced, having them shipped to a distribution point, (over seas I might add) paying trade and shippin, customs taxes, having the supply stored someplace, and then the costs of distributing them world wide to all you NS fans, would cost around $6,000+ at the very least bare bones. So it would probably be even more.

    Thats per model as in a gorge or onos only.

    Oh yea the size and material quality are other expenses that havnt been added in yet.

    Thats not including the costs of dividing up royalties to the creators, and legal fees to commercial lawyers for the legal aspects.
